Celtics’ Twitter account burns Hawks

A Twitter user wrote he got his father tickets to a Boston Celtics game for Christmas, but there was a problem— the game will be against the two-win Atlanta Hawks.
The Hawks took the 10-win Celtics to the wire on Monday night, but lost the game 110-107.
The Hawks Twitter account decided to get involved and convince the Celtics’ fan that watching the Hawks play might not be the worst thing.

The Hawks and Celtics play two more times this season, once at Philips Arena on Nov. 18 and once on Feb. 2 at Boston's TD Garden.
The Hawks travel to Detroit to play the Pistons on Friday at 7 p.m. while the Celtics host the Charlotte Hornets at 7:30 p.m.
